Alphabet CEO Pichai Faces Scrutiny Over Record-Keeping at Google Play Trial

Alphabet CEO Sundar Pichai testified in federal court to defend Google against antitrust claims by Epic Games, accusing the company of using illegal tactics to maintain dominance in the mobile-app distribution marketplace. Pichai argued that Google has acted appropriately in the face of competition from giants like Apple and Samsung, and any harms to consumers are outweighed by the benefits Google has provided. Epic's lawyers tried to show that Google has prevented rival app stores from cutting into its profit through revenue-share agreements and deals with app developers. Pichai confirmed that Google gives Apple a 36% share of advertising revenue from searches in the Safari browser. The trial could potentially impact Google's revenue if it is forced to open the door for payment and app distribution methods outside its own app store.
